  • Title

    A VLSI architecture for radix-2k Viterbi decoding with transpose algorithm

  • Abstract
    The paper presents a novel transpose path metric (TPM) algorithm to reduce the interconnection routing complexity for a radix-2k Viterbi decoder. With simple local interconnections, the algorithm can provide a permutation function for state rearrangement in a transpose strategy. With features of modulation and regularity, this algorithm is very suitable for VLSI implementation; consequently, a larger memory length VA decoder can be constructed with several smaller memory length modules. Finally, a VLSI architecture for a 16-states radix-4 VA decoder using TPM has been developed
